Mole Lake, WI vs Shell Lake, WI
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Mole Lake is 17.7% cheaper than Shell Lake. With a cost index of 59 vs 72,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Mole Lake to Shell Lake should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Mole Lake is $493/month compared to $713/month in Shell Lake — a 31%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Mole Lake is more affordable at $133,700 median vs $207,100.
Median household income in Mole Lake is $40,000 compared to $56,875 in Shell Lake (-29.7%). While Shell Lake is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Mole Lake spend roughly 14.8% of their income on rent, less than the 15% in Shell Lake.
